如何创建云数据库服务器?

创建云数据库服务器涉及选择云服务商、确定数据库类型、配置服务器规格、设置安全策略和进行部署。

创建云数据库服务器是一个涉及多个步骤和技术细节的过程,以下是一个详细的指南,包括选择合适的云服务提供商、配置硬件资源、安装和配置数据库软件、确保数据安全和备份以及监控和优化性能等关键步骤:

创建云数据库服务器

1、选择合适的云服务提供商

主要提供商:市场上主要的云服务提供商包括Amazon Web Services (AWS)、Microsoft Azure、Google Cloud Platform (GCP)和阿里云,这些提供商各有优势,如AWS的全球基础设施和高可靠性,Azure与微软产品的集成,GCP的强大数据分析能力,以及阿里云在亚太地区的本地化服务。

2、配置硬件资源

计算资源:根据数据库应用的需求选择合适的CPU和内存配置,在线事务处理(OLTP)系统通常需要高性能的CPU和内存,而在线分析处理(OLAP)系统可能需要更多的内存和存储。

存储资源:选择适合的硬盘类型和容量,SSD具有更高的读写速度,适合高性能需求的数据库应用,存储容量应根据数据库的大小和增长预估进行配置。

网络资源:配置网络带宽和网络安全设置,如防火墙规则和VPC(虚拟私有云),以确保数据库的安全性和访问速度。

3、安装和配置数据库软件

安装数据库:以MySQL为例,可以通过下载MySQL安装包并运行安装程序来完成安装,大多数云服务提供商提供一键安装选项,简化了安装过程。

配置数据库参数:安装完成后,需要对数据库参数进行配置,如最大连接数、缓存大小、日志文件位置等,这些参数直接影响数据库的性能和稳定性。

创建云数据库服务器

4、确保数据安全和备份

数据加密:使用SSL/TLS协议进行数据传输加密,利用数据库自带的加密功能或第三方工具进行存储数据加密。

访问控制:实施严格的访问控制措施,设置数据库用户和权限,遵循最小权限原则,只赋予用户所需的最低权限。

定期备份:设置自动备份策略,如每日或每周备份,并将备份数据存储在不同的物理位置以防灾难性故障。

5、监控和优化性能

性能监控:使用数据库自带的监控工具或第三方监控工具,如AWS CloudWatch、Azure Monitor等,监控CPU使用率、内存使用率、磁盘I/O等关键指标。

日志分析:通过分析数据库日志,发现和解决潜在问题,可以使用数据库自带的日志功能或第三方日志分析工具。

性能优化:包括数据库表结构优化、索引优化和查询优化等,MySQL的EXPLAIN命令可以帮助分析查询性能。

以下是两个相关FAQs及其解答:

创建云数据库服务器

1、Q: 什么是云数据库服务器?

A: 云数据库服务器是一种基于云计算技术的数据库服务,它允许用户在云平台上轻松创建、管理和维护数据库,通过云数据库服务器,用户可以实现数据的存储、查询和分析,无需自行购买硬件设备或搭建数据库环境。

2、Q: 如何创建云数据库服务器?

A: 创建云数据库服务器通常需要以下步骤:选择合适的云服务提供商,登录云服务提供商的控制台或管理平台,进入数据库服务界面;在数据库服务界面中选择创建数据库实例,根据需求选择合适的数据库类型、版本和配置;设置数据库的名称、访问权限、备份策略等参数,并选择合适的存储空间;确认配置无误后,提交创建请求,等待云服务提供商完成数据库实例的创建;创建完成后,获取数据库实例的连接信息,并使用合适的数据库管理工具连接到云数据库服务器。

创建云数据库服务器是一个系统工程,需要综合考虑多个因素,通过合理的规划和配置,可以确保数据库的高效运行和数据的安全性。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1410532.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希的头像未希新媒体运营
上一篇 2024-12-15 08:36
下一篇 2024-04-01 10:30

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入